Slow Draining Water in Sinks and Bathtubs


One of the earliest signs of drain trouble is water that drains slowly. If you notice that water pools in your sink, bathtub, or shower instead of flowing freely, it usually means there is a blockage somewhere in the drain line. In Fort Myers, common causes include:


  • Accumulated hair and soap scum

  • Grease buildup from kitchen drains

  • Tree roots infiltrating underground pipes


Ignoring slow drainage can lead to complete clogs, causing water to back up and potentially damage your floors and walls.


Foul Odors Coming from Drains


Unpleasant smells coming from your drains are a clear warning sign. These odors often result from trapped debris, stagnant water, or sewer gases escaping through damaged pipes. In humid climates like Fort Myers, bacteria and mold can grow quickly in clogged drains, intensifying the smell.


If you notice persistent foul odors, it’s a good idea to inspect your drains and schedule a repair before the problem worsens.


Gurgling Sounds from Drains


Hearing gurgling noises when water drains is a sign that air is trapped in your plumbing system. This usually happens when there is a partial blockage or venting issue. The gurgling sound means water is struggling to flow through the pipes, which can lead to backups or leaks.


In Fort Myers homes, gurgling drains often indicate the need for professional inspection and repair to prevent more serious plumbing failures.


Water Backing Up into Fixtures


Water backing up into sinks, tubs, or toilets is a serious sign of drain problems. This usually means a clog is blocking the normal flow of wastewater. Backups can cause water damage, promote mold growth, and create unsanitary conditions.


If you experience water backing up, especially after heavy rain or multiple uses of water fixtures, it’s time to call a drain repair expert in Fort Myers to diagnose and fix the issue.


Visible Signs of Drain Damage


Sometimes, the signs of drain trouble are visible outside your home. Look for:


  • Pools of standing water near your foundation

  • Wet or soggy spots in your yard

  • Cracks or shifts in concrete near drain lines

  • Unusual plant growth over underground pipes


These signs often indicate broken or leaking drain pipes underground. In Fort Myers, where soil conditions and tree roots can affect pipes, early detection is crucial to avoid expensive repairs.


Frequent Need for Drain Cleaning


If you find yourself calling for drain cleaning more often than usual, it may mean your drains are deteriorating or damaged. Frequent clogs can signal pipe corrosion, root intrusion, or pipe misalignment.


Professional drain repair can address the root cause, restoring proper flow and reducing the need for repeated cleanings.


Increased Pest Activity Near Drains


Drains that are damaged or clogged can attract pests like cockroaches, drain flies, and rodents. These pests thrive in moist, dirty environments and can enter your home through compromised drain pipes.


If you notice more pests around your drains, it’s a sign to inspect and repair your drainage system to protect your home’s hygiene.


Changes in Water Pressure or Flow


Sometimes drain issues affect water pressure or flow in your home. If water pressure drops suddenly or fluctuates when using multiple fixtures, it could be due to blockages or leaks in the drain system.
